I grew up in Michigan's Upper Peninsula in a small
town called Ontanagon where I lived on a farm with my parents and my two
brothers and sisters. I had your average childhood, you know, I went
to school, did chores around the farm, fought with my brothers and sisters...that
sort of thing. I enjoyed working with the animals on the farm and
I had planned to go to Michigan State University (Moo U) to get an agricultural
science degree. Well, I guess the fates had something else in store
for me...
This was the summer before I was to go off to MSU.
I was in the stable working with my horse, Bonnie, when she started getting
antsy. I tried to calm her down but she started to buck and get more skittish.
I looked around the stable to see what was making her so nervous.
She pulled the reins out of my hand, giving me a nasty rope burn, and ran
out of the stable. I lost my temper and took off after her yelling
at her to stop. She wouldn't listen and I got even angrier.
Bonnie looked back at me and ran even faster away from me. I yelled
(growled) at her and chased her over the property line fence, tackled her,
knocked her unconscious, and carried her back into the stable. Then,
my parents came into the stable holding my torn clothes and wondering what
all the noise was. I was lowering Bonnie into her stall when I heard
my mother scream. I spun around to see what she was screaming about
and ran headfirst into the stall door frame eight and a half feet off the
ground. Then reality came crashing in as my anger faded away and
I realized what I had just done. I fell to my knees shaking, all
8'10", 800 pounds of me. My mom ran in and gave me a hug.
My anger left me and I returned to my naked, human form as she helped me
back into the house.
That night, she and my dad explained what I was.
They explained that this was a "gift" that ran in
the family and that it was genetic and not a disease that I got infected
with. They explained some of the other misconceptions about Garou,
or werewolves, as well, such as I was not an evil monster who was going
to go off at the full moon and kill people and that I could learn to control
my "gift". Let's just say that I didn't get much sleep that night.
The next day, I was out in the stable checking on Bonnie, who was
still a little nervous around me but nothing like the day before, when
my dad called me into the house. There were two strangers waiting
for me. They introduced themselves as Phil Morningstar and Frostrunner
from the Sept of Gaia's Strength. They said that they were here to
take me away to be with others like me and to teach me things I could only
learn with them. I took this news as well as any teenager would...I said,
"I don't think so." Then my mom surprised me and, with tears in her
eyes, she said that I had a greater responsibility and that so few now
were "chosen" and that she was so proud that I had been "selected".
She said that I needed to go with them to learn to control the "gift" and
use it to help the world. I was stunned by what she said and, as
I looked at my father, he just nodded his head and gave me a hug.
We said our good-byes and I headed off for my new home...
